About This Item

In the small town of Conner's, Georgia , Darcy has just started high school; her older sister, Adel, goes to dances at the army base; and their mother tends to her beautiful garden, the biggest and best in town. It's 1974, and the country is struggling to come to terms with the Vietnam War. But Darcy's world is changing forever when her mother goes to Atlanta for tests. The diagnosis is not good- breast cancer.

There is so much Darcy wants to talk to her mother about: the war and what happened to the soldiers who were in it; the feelings she is having for the new (and troubled) boy in school. But she can't. So she finds solace in her mother's garden. There she can help the flowers that her mother planted boom.
